Navigating Career Paths: Highlights from the First Bahrenfeld Postdoc Welcome Night
The Bahrenfeld campus recently hosted the first edition of the Postdoc Welcome Night, an event organized by PIER – Partnership of Universität Hamburg and DESY, together with the MIN Graduate Center. The evening welcomed postdocs from a wide range of research clusters including the University of Hamburg, Cluster of Excellence Quantum Universe, CUI: Advanced Imaging of Matter, CLICCS, and DESY, creating a vibrant space for career reflection, networking, and shared experiences.
Following a warm introduction to the support structures provided by the MIN Faculty and PIER, postdocs split into two interactive mini-workshops designed to address a central theme in their professional lives: career development.
In the “Career Paths within Academia” workshop, Prof. Dr. Annette Eschenbach and Prof. Dr. Eliza Schaum joined postdocs for a round table discussion in an informal setting. This open format encouraged participants to engage freely with the speakers, share personal concerns and aspirations, and gain first-hand insight into navigating academic career trajectories.
Meanwhile, the “Career Paths Outside of Academia” session featured a talk by Anne Schreiter, Ph.D. from the Guidance, Skills and Opportunities (GSO). Schreiter offered practical advice tailored to scientists looking to transition beyond academia, including strategies for identifying transferable skills and exploring roles in industry and public sector, amongst others.
The evening concluded with relaxed networking over snacks and drinks, providing a welcome opportunity for participants to connect informally, exchange experiences, and build community.
